Raju Bhaiya: Kanpur to Mumbai
Born on 25 December 1963 in Kidwainagar N Block Nayapurwa.
– Passed high school examination from Subhash Inter College Saket Nagar in 1979.
In 1982, passed the Inter examination from Shri Ratna Shukla Inter College Juhi.
In 1982, his guru Rajendra Prasad gave the first stage program in the city itself.
– Moved to Mumbai in 1983.
In 1989, he played the role of a truck cleaner in the film Maine Pyar Kiya.
In 1993, he played the role of a college student in the movie Baazigar.
In 2001, he played the role of Baba Chin Chin Chu in Aamne Athni Kharkha Rupaiya.
– Wow in 2002! Played the role of Banne Khan’s assistant in the movie Tera Kya Kehna.
In 2003, he played the role of Shambhu in the film Main Prem Ki Deewani Hoon.
In 2005, came the Great India Laughter Challenge and was the second runner up.
In 2006, he played the role of Inspector JK in the film Vidyarthi: The Power of Students.
– Played the role of an auto driver in the film Big Brother in 2007.
– Played the role of Anthony Gonsalves in the film Bombay to Goa in 2007.
In 2007, she played the role of Daya from Gaya in the film Feelings of Understanding.
In 2009, Big Boss came in season three and on December 4, the vote was out.
In 2013, took part in Nach Baliye season six with wife Shikha.

Expressed love after being successful
In 1982, at a relative’s wedding, Raju met Shikha Srivastava in Fatehpur. In his mind, Raju started liking him, but this was the initial phase of his career and he had nothing of his own. After that he moved to Mumbai. After many years of struggle, when he made a name for himself and made a home in Mumbai, then he proposed marriage to Shikha. He married Shikha in 1993. They have two children Antara and Ayushmann Srivastava.
